Meghalaya witnesses active participation from elderly voters across the state

Shillong, April 19: Citizens over 85 years participated actively in the electoral process, with over 10,180 voters exercised their rights in various polling booths across the state.

The total electorate of the state stands at 2,217,100. The active participation and representation from the senior citizen reflects the diverse demographics of Meghalaya’s voting population.

10,000 plus elderly voters in the state reaffirms inclusivity in democratic participation in the state.
